We forgot to mention this but it's a good of a time as any. Blizzard has now launched its official StarCraft II community web presence via the Battle.net web site. Unlike the main StarCraft2.com site, the community web page will be the place for news updates on the sci-fi RTS game, along with an official game guild (coming soon) and more.
One part of the community site talks about the common terms used in StarCraft II that are used in the vast StarCraft fan community (do you know what a BioBall is?). Another part of the site goes over the game's new Challenge levels that are meant to be a bridge between playing the single player game and heading out to play with others online. You can expect lots more updates on the site before and after StarCraft II's launch on July 27.
